TE AROHA S.M. COURT.
-. —» — /FRIDAY, OCTOBER 25, 1895
. (Before B. S /Bush,: Esq., E.M) • Jas/Orr, (if Gordon Settlement, .was charged by the Kegistrur of Births, that he failed to register the birth of iris child within the -prescribed time allowed. . ' . -
- Defendant pleaded guilty. Ordered to pay a fine of ss, and costs 7s. , Huberts and liowe were charged on tho information of the Inspector, of Slaughter-houses that they did so dis pose of blood and refuse from slaughter so as to cause a nuisance' Defendants pleaded guilty. . Inspector said it was the first offence. Fined 5s and costs 7s.
